                    Provenance
        Possibly purchased by Isabella Stewart Gardner when she visited the Taj Mahal, Agra during her trip to India in March 1884.
                    Commentary
        This miniature portrait is one of three which memorialize Isabella Stewart Gardner’s visit to Agra, India. This one depicts the Mughal emperor, Akbar (1542-1605). Isabella Stewart Gardner traveled extensively in Asia and visited the Taj Mahal in March of 1884.  In a letter to her friend Maud Howe, she wrote “The Taj perfect—a pearl.”
